Good question, but thankfully the answer is no.
RPC over HTTP uses the \RPC virtual directory and never deals with the
Default Web Site, so changes to the DWS do not affect RPC over HTTP.
Basically RPC over HTTP goes directly to the \RPC VDir, bypassing the DWS.
